        Opera 29.0.1795.60 doesn't allow to Reload images in the Speed Dial - this feature seems to be (temporarily?) dropped/disabled.
        Even after enabling #hi-resolution-thumbnails and #hidpi-speed-dial-tiles in opera://flags/ the speed dial images stay pre-defined and static.

          This is because the new speed dial page in opera 29 has a totally different backend (they now use the same backend as the bookmarks manager) and an option to refresh doesn't seem to be implemented on the new backend (at least currently)

                          Found my own work-around, that's working in V32 (my work install doesn't update automatically, presumably a network issue).

                          Go the website using the speed-dial link, click the heart and choose a new picture. It will update the speed-dial accordingly. Would still be nice to just right-click and edit, but at least there is a way around without deleting all of them and starting again.
